use std::path::PathBuf;
use crate::{
database_drivers,
utils::{get_local_migrations, read_file_content},
};
use anyhow::{bail, Result};
use log::info;
pub async fn status(
database_url: String,
database_token: Option<String>,
migration_table: String,
migration_folder: String,
schema_file: String,
wait_timeout: Option<usize>,
verbose: bool,
) -> Result<()> {
let mut database = database_drivers::new(
database_url,
database_token,
migration_table,
migration_folder.clone(),
schema_file,
wait_timeout,
true,
)
.await?;
let path = PathBuf::from(&migration_folder);
let files = match get_local_migrations(&path, "up") {
Ok(f) => f,
Err(err) => {
bail!("Couldn't read migration folder: {:?}", err)
}
};
let migrations: Vec<String> = database
.get_or_create_schema_migrations()
.await?
.into_iter()
.map(|s| s.into_boxed_str())
.collect::<Vec<Box<str>>>()
.into_iter()
.map(|s| s.into())
.collect();
compare_migrations_and_log(files, migrations, verbose);
Ok(())
}
fn compare_migrations_and_log(files: Vec<(i64, PathBuf)>, migrations: Vec<String>, verbose: bool) {
for f in files {
let id = Box::new(f.0.to_string());
if !migrations.contains(&id) {
if verbose {
let query = read_file_content(&f.1);
info!("Pending migration {}: \n {}", id, query);
} else {
info!("Pending {}", id);
}
}
}
}
